Bahati Cries His Eyes Out As He Is Asked To Step Down From Mathare Mp Race

by Ramskie Duevela

 

Earlier today, Bahati addressed the press to air out his grievances.

Bahati expressed his disappointment and hurt as he was asked to recall his certificate and step down from the race for the current member of parliament representing Mathare.

Bahati claims that the reason he was asked to step down is because the MP of Mathare feels threatened by him and feels like he stands no chance against Bahati as he allegedly has support from the inhabitants of Mathare.

“I am being told I need to recall the certificate and step down for the seating mp because he is threatened and feels like if I am in the ballot, the seat won’t go back to ODM …”

He additionally claimed that there’s zoning of areas in the country and Mathare has unfortunately been zoned as an ODM area hence they do not want anyone with another party, Jubilee in this case, take the win.

“ I know there is zoning and Mathare has been zoned as an ODM area. Please give the youth a chance . Give the people of Mathare a chance to get the leader they have always wanted…”

Bahati even went ahead to pull the “all the favors I did for you” card with the hope that the president and Raila Odinga will reconsider their decision of asking him to step down.

you know so well that I am a loyal member of the jubilee party I campaigned for the president in 2017. I did 555 stops around the country. Mr. President and the party officials in Jubilee even the ones that left know my loyalty to you to the fifth Raila Amollo Odinga, I am the only urban artist in this country that officially stood up and endorsed you. I even did a song without pay. That shows I am supporting the azimio vision. Please do not kill the hearts of the youth in azimio….”

I request you to intervene and in a humble way I say no and I am not recalling my certificate and I will be on the ballot on the 9th of August…”
